  • How do you present statistics in a table?

    Ideally, every table should:

    1. Be self-explanatory;
    2. Present values with the same number of decimal places in all its cells (standardization);
    3. Include a title informing what is being described and where, as well as the number of observations (N) and when data were collected;

  • How do you read a statistical analysis table?

    How to read a table: 1- Identify the population under study; 2- Identify the variable(s) presented in the table; 3- Identify the measuring unit used (frequencies, percentages, rates, etc.); 4- Read the information presented in table cells.
    These rules can be put into practice using the table from the example below..

  • What is a statistical table in statistics?

    A statistical table is a method used to present statistical data by arranging the numbers systematically and describing some mass processes.
    This table can be seen as a representation of a subject and a predicate.
    The group of the phenomenon discussed in the table is the subject..

  • There are four commonly used statistical tables, namely Student's t, Unit Normal Distribution or Z, chi-square, and F tables.
  • To read a statistical table, look at the title, then look at the headings.
    Using the categories at the top and left side of the table, read across a row and down a column to locate specific information.
